Alphonse Gabriel Capone, notoriously referred to "Scarface," ruled the streets of Chicago for over a decade (1919 - 1930) During these years, Capone rose to power through any means necessary, which included but was not limited to: bootlegging, gambling, prostitution, assault, theft, arson, and murder. When Elliot Ness brought down Capone in 1930, the authorities did donrrrt you have enough evidence to charge him with any of the above incidents. However, it is understandable that the most famous Gagster in American History was arrested and jailed solely for income tax evasion.
